Security Concerns and Regional Instability
Nigeria continues to grapple with significant security challenges, particularly in the northern and eastern regions of the country. Ongoing conflicts, banditry, and the threat of terrorism pose serious risks to the stability of the nation. Efforts to address these security concerns are ongoing, with the deployment of military forces and the implementation of various security initiatives.
The impact of these security challenges extends beyond physical safety, also affecting economic activity and social cohesion. Addressing the root causes of conflict and promoting sustainable peace are critical priorities for the government.
- Boko Haram insurgency in the Northeast
- Farmer-herder conflicts in the Middle Belt
- Piracy and maritime insecurity in the Gulf of Guinea
- Communal clashes and violence in various regions

Healthcare System Strain and Access to Services
Nigeria’s healthcare system is facing significant strain, struggling to meet the needs of a rapidly growing population. Limited access to healthcare services, particularly in rural areas, remains a major challenge. Inadequate funding, a shortage of healthcare professionals, and dilapidated infrastructure are contributing to the crisis. Improving healthcare infrastructure and increasing investment in human resources are essential for ensuring access to quality healthcare services.
Strengthening the healthcare system requires a multi-faceted approach, including increased funding, improved governance, and enhanced public-private partnerships. Addressing the social determinants of health, such as poverty and sanitation, is also crucial for improving health outcomes.
